Coles supermarket issues urgent NATIONWIDE recall for popular food available in Sydney, Melbourne, Australia and Online

Three different varieties of frozen pizza have been recalled from Coles over an undeclared allergen.

The supermarket issued the recall on Friday for the pizza, which is sold in stores and Coles Online across the country.

Labels on the pizza advise the products are “suitable for vegans”.

However, dairy is present in the products but not specified on the labels, prompting the recall.

The affected products include:

  • Coles Nature’s Kitchen Meat-free Hawaiian Style Pizza 250gm (all Best Before dates)
  • Coles Nature’s Kitchen Meat-free Meat Lovers Pizza 250gm (all Best Before dates)
  • Coles Nature’s Kitchen Supreme Veggie Pizza 250gm (all Best Before dates)

The affected products have been available for purchase since February 2021.

Coles issues apology

Customers who have a dairy allergy or intolerance may have a reaction if they consume the pizza.

Customers are able to return the product to Coles for a full refund.

“We apologise to our customers for any inconvenience,” Coles siad.

People seeking further information can contact Coles Customer Care on 1800 061 562.
